Output 5b06124036810844d02104ae9e16027ab537233670bd5237ea2a0c83d60b6c58:0

value
37680710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c2124ce6875f04103a6f5b0936beb22bd83694 OP_EQUAL
address
MEu25LEubZmDYgwZE8cT3ThyrdNLGVpoU3
transaction
5b06124036810844d02104ae9e16027ab537233670bd5237ea2a0c83d60b6c58
spent
true